Virgo Sun + Scorpio Moon + Libra Rising

Your little Virgo notices everything. Thoughtful, gentle, and surprisingly organized for someone in diapers, this tiny perfectionist will charm you with their quiet determination. With a Scorpio moon, expect intensity, deep attachment, and eyes that see everything you think you're hiding. A Libra rising means they'll show up charming, easy, and instantly likable to every stranger.

The Virgo–Scorpio–Libra mix

Out in the world — at a café, a playdate, a family gathering — your little Virgo comes across as genuinely easy: attentive, smiley, the baby who tilts their head and studies a stranger's face with polite curiosity. That Libra Rising is doing real work, smoothing every edge and projecting calm approachability. But get home, get the lights low, get close to bedtime, and a completely different current moves through this baby. The Scorpio Moon doesn't surface gradually — it arrives. Feelings that were neatly held in check all day press up all at once: the need for intensity, for closeness, for proof that you're really there. What makes this combo genuinely fascinating is that the Virgo Sun sits between those two — grounding the Scorpio emotional surge into something more manageable during the day, while quietly cataloguing every sensory detail the Libra Rising smiled through. This baby notices what others miss and feels what they noticed, privately.

Living with your little Virgo

The surprise for most parents of this combo is the gap between public ease and private intensity. Your baby transitions out of social situations beautifully — Libra Rising helps them disengage gracefully — but they often need a longer, quieter decompression window than you'd expect from such a 'chill' baby. Loud competing sounds overstimulate faster than visual busyness does. Consistent, predictable wind-down rituals work especially well here because Virgo's Earth grounding and Scorpio's Fixed staying-power together mean this baby settles deeply once the pattern feels safe.

Frequently asked questions

Why does my Virgo Sun, Scorpio Moon, Libra Rising baby seem so relaxed with strangers but intense with me at home?

That's exactly the rising-versus-moon split at work. Libra Rising gives your baby a genuinely warm, socially graceful front — strangers get the easy version. But Scorpio Moon reserves its full emotional depth for the people this baby trusts completely. You're not seeing a problem; you're seeing how deeply they've let you in. The Virgo Sun helps them hold it together all day, which makes the release feel bigger once they're home with you.

Is a Virgo Sun, Scorpio Moon baby overly sensitive or just very perceptive?

Both, honestly — and they're not separate things for this combination. The Virgo Sun picks up on small discrepancies and inconsistencies that most babies let slide; the Scorpio Moon then assigns emotional weight to those observations. So your baby isn't being 'dramatic' when a subtle shift in your tone or routine registers strongly — they genuinely caught something real. Consistency and honest warmth tend to work far better than distraction-based soothing for this particular mix.

Will my Virgo Sun, Scorpio Moon, Libra Rising baby be shy or outgoing?

Neither label fits neatly here. The Libra Rising gives them a genuinely social, engaging first impression — they're not standoffish with new people. But 'outgoing' undersells the careful observation happening underneath. This baby warms up quickly in terms of surface manner but takes longer to emotionally commit to a new person or environment. Think of it as socially confident but emotionally selective, which is a genuinely useful combination as they grow.
